CHET BAKER SOLOS VOLUME 2 ABOUT THE MUSIC Chet Baker was, without a doubt, one of the most Instinctively melacic improvisers in the histary of fpzz. Countless musicians have been inspired and amazed by his ability to.create such powerful music through relatively midclest means. His choice of notes was impeccable. his phrasing always fresh and unpredictable and his intimate, lyiieal style of playing still serves a8 an excellent moctel fo H aspiring jazz musichans andl truly epitomizes thé phrase “less ls more”, This book contains eleven transcriptions trom three albumis that Chet recorded on the Steeplechase abel trom the late seventies through the mid-eighties. Two of the albums, "Daybreak" ancl “Someday My Prince Will Come”. are part of a wonderful set of live recordings done In Montmartre in. 1979 and feature Chet along with Doug Raney and Niels-Henning Orvted Pedersen, The transcriptions contained In this book from these alburns = Ghi¢, Love Vibrations, and You Can't Go Home ~are all previously unissiied tracks that are pretently Included In the CD fortnats. Transcriptions of the originally T3sued racks ave available in an eatlier book of Chet Baker solos published by Advance Music. The other tranvcriptions in this Boole all come from a duo alburn featuring Chet Baker anid Paul Bley entided “Diane”. This recotding finds boiti Chet and Paul fey adapting thelr styles to-one anotlier to create some beautifully unpretentious music. Throughout each of these transcriptions, marklnigs have been frequently and carefully placed in order to reflect Chet's varied phrasing. and articulations. When combined with thorough stucty of the record ings, examination of these markings will hopefully be helpful in getting at the heart of Chet's personal sound. In the three soles from the ilo recordings: the chord symbols provided are generally the same fot each chorus, reflecting the basic changes for the tune. Ih the solos fhofn the duo recneding. the hotel symbols vary from chorus to chorus In an effort £0 reflect the sppocific substitutions and color ations that Paul Bley used) | feel that since Chet’s musical chielces (on this recording in particular) relied heavily on the sounds he was hearing around him, the study of those specific sounds and Chet’s re- actions to them can greatly Increase our understanding of the music. Chet Baker is certaiity a-musician wotthy of serious study, and the music represented in these trans~ ctiptions holds valuable insight for jazz musicians, regardless of Instrument or ability, | hape that studying and playing this music bring you as much enjoyment as Ithas brought me: Joe! ior TABLE OF CONTENTS Diane (1985) (SteupleChase SCCD-31207) If 1 Should Lose You.
